CVE-2025-39821Public exploit

Kernel control-flow hijack via inactive perf events

Published Sep 16, 2025 · Updated Sep 16, 2025

Use-after-free in Linux kernel perf event throttling in 6.16 through 6.16.4 allows local users to hijack kernel control flow. perf_event_throttle() and perf_event_unthrottle() start or stop an unscheduled disabled sibling whose hw.idx remains -1, leaving its hrtimer queued after the event is freed. An unprivileged process reaches the flaw through task-scoped perf_event_open() groups at the default paranoid setting, enabling kernel-memory disclosure or corruption, control-flow hijacking, and kernel crashes.
